Food Hall Itinerary:
10.30am Meet at Sheffield Plate Food Hall in Orchard Square.
Session One - Students complete their Food Hall Activity Workbook, which helps familiarise students with the food hall, vendors, their menus and dishes - view sample workbook
3 Courses included - 2 courses from a range of street food vendors, including Latin American, Sri Lankan, Korean and Italian, PLUS a dessert.
Vendor talks - hear from some of the food hall vendors in a Q&A session. Hear their story, how they run their business and how the dishes are made - view sample questions.
Talk and tasting from Bullion Chocolate - hear how bean-to-bar craft chocolate is made from this award-winning chocolate maker and sample some of their incredible chocolate as well as one of their brownies for dessert.
A short walk and history talk up to Leah's Yard for a look around and some free time to also have a look at Cambridge Street Collective - Europe's largest purpose-built food hall.
Minimum students, 20, maximum 40.
Ends around 2pm
Price £38 per student / £28 for staff
